To understand "The Truman Show Okru 2021," we must understand the platform. Ok.ru (Odnoklassniki, meaning "Classmates") launched in 2006 as a Russian social network. While Western audiences favor YouTube, Netflix, or Disney+, Ok.ru evolved into a unique hybrid: part Facebook, part YouTube, and, crucially, a massive repository of free, user-uploaded movies.
Throughout the 2010s and into 2021, Ok.ru became a digital back-alley for cinephiles. Because of lax content moderation and Russia’s unique copyright enforcement environment (historically more tolerant of infringing content, especially from Western studios), Ok.ru hosted thousands of films that were difficult to find elsewhere. For a movie like The Truman Show, which was not always available on every streaming service in every region, Ok.ru offered a lifeline—no subscription, no account required, just a search bar and a working link.

Below is a structured paper outline and analysis based on the film's core themes. The Truman Show: A Modern Reality Analysis 1. Synopsis: The Fabricated Life
Starring Jim Carrey, the film follows Truman Burbank, a man living in the idyllic town of Seahaven. Unbeknownst to him, his entire life is a 24/7 reality television show the truman show okru 2021
directed by a "creator" named Christof. Every person in his life—including his wife and best friend—is a paid actor, and the town itself is a massive soundstage. 2. Core Themes and Philosophies The Conflict of Reality vs. Artificiality : The film serves as a modern reflection of Plato’s Allegory of the Cave
, where the protagonist must distinguish between a manufactured shadow-world and true reality. Media Manipulation and Consumerism
: The show is financed through extreme product placement, where actors break character to pitch items directly to the camera, highlighting how commercial interests can commodify a human life. Surveillance and Autonomy
: Decades after its release, critics argue the film feels less like fiction and more like a documentary of our current era of social media surveillance 3. Critical Techniques
Director Peter Weir used specific cinematic choices to emphasize Truman's entrapment: Vignetting
: Many shots have darkened edges to simulate hidden cameras tucked into clocks, buttons, or streetlights. Utopian Aesthetic
: The forced perfection of Seahaven highlights the "uncanny valley" of a scripted existence. The American Society of Cinematographers 4. Legacy and the "Truman Show Delusion"
The film's impact was so profound that it led to the naming of the Truman Show delusion
, a psychological condition where individuals believe their lives are staged reality shows for others' entertainment. Conclusion
Truman's eventual escape—walking through a door in the "sky"—symbolizes the human spirit's need for genuine autonomy
over scripted comfort. For modern viewers, especially those revisiting the film in the 2020s, it serves as a stark warning about the loss of privacy in a digitally connected world. Art of Smart analysis or a character study of Christof?

Truman Burbank lives in the idyllic town of Seahaven, where the sun always shines and every neighbor is friendly. Unknown to him, he is the star of " The Truman Show
," a 24/7 global broadcast that has filmed every second of his life since birth. The Fabricated Reality
The Dome: Seahaven is a massive television studio enclosed in a giant dome, visible even from space.
The Cast: Every person Truman knows, including his wife Meryl and best friend Marlon, is a paid actor.
The Director: Christof, the show's creator, manipulates Truman’s environment—controlling the weather and even staging his father’s "death" at sea to instill a phobia of water that keeps Truman from leaving the island. The Crack in the Mirror
In 2021, the film's themes of media manipulation and surveillance felt more relevant than ever as digital "echo chambers" and social media algorithms became central to daily life. For Truman, the awakening begins with small glitches: A studio light falls from the "sky". His car radio accidentally picks up the director's cues.
He notices the same people and cars traveling in loops around his block. The Final Choice
Truman eventually overcomes his fear of the ocean and sails to the edge of his world. He discovers a physical wall painted like the sky and a staircase leading to an "EXIT". The Truman Show Summary - GradeSaver
